#d89cb0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d89cb0 is composed of 84.7% red, 61.2%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.8% magenta, 18.5%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 340 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 72.9%. #d89cb0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b13961.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#d89cb0 color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#d89cb0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d89cb0 has RGB values of R:216, G:156,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.19,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14195888.

Shades and Tints of #d89cb0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0508 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d89cb0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db7b9 is the less saturated color, while #fd77a4 is the most saturated one.
